Abstract
This paper proposed an n-graylevel encoding method to hide digital images. First of all, transform every pixel value of a covert image into n-graylevel codes, and then these n-graylevel codes are embedded into a host image with a specific encoding rule. The proposed method use n-graylevel encoding method can hide digital images into a host image to form an overt image with n-graylevel codes. All pixel elements of the overt image can be found into five categories, which are respectively as identification codes, image graylevel codes, dimension codes, n-graylevel codes, and information codes. The proposed method can hide digital images, good security, fast calculation, saving space, and the overt image is almost the same as the host image. The covert image can be directly decoded from the overt image not using the host image, and then the decoded covert image and the original covert image are all the same.
